Junior Driver Champs qualifying period and structure

The qualifying period and qualifying structure for the 2021 New Zealand Junior Driver Championship has now been confirmed.

The qualifying period for the Championship will be from August 1 2020 - June 14 2021

After consultation with previous and current Junior Drivers throughout the Country the qualifying structure for the 2021 Championships is below: 

As of August 1 2020
All Junior Driver Races 
1st=7 points,  2nd=5 points, 3rd=3 points, 4th=2 points, 5th=1 point
 
All Other Races:
1st=5 points, 2nd=3 points, 3rd=2 points
Please note that the Junior Driver Points page on our website is currently not displaying due to our IT team making the above changes to the points system. We anticipate this to be up and running again in the next couple of weeks.

It is anticipated that the Championship will be held in July 2021 - dates to be confirmed.
